POWDER FILLED TUBE AND A METHOD FOR THE CONTINUOUS MANUFACTURE OF SUCH TUBE ABSTRACT OF THE DISCLOSURE A powder filled tube has a steel outer wall which consists of two layers formed as two complete turns of a spiral made from a single strip and welded together at their interface to form a unitary wall. The method for the continuous manufacture of this tube involves (i) forming a steel strip into a channel, (ii) introducing the powder filling into the channel, (iii) closing the channel by rolling it into a tube in which, as seen in cross section, the steel strip overlaps itself by at least 360° so that the tube wall has two layers around its whole circumference and the powder filling is compacted, (iv) heating the tube and while hot subjecting it to stretch/reduction rolling in which simultaneous size reduction and extension of length take place and in which the two wall layers are welded together by the effect of the elevated temperature and the pressure applied in rolling.
